  • Patent number: 5983040
    Abstract: A camera comprises a cover of a stowage chamber, such as a film cartridge chamber, and a friction member for giving substantially constant opening-operation resistance to the cover substantially throughout the entirety of a movement range in which the cover shifts from a closed state to a half-opened state, so that the cover is gradually opened by the friction force of the friction member. Thus, an object stored in the stowage chamber is prevented from abruptly popping out of the stowage chamber, and a user's feeling at the time of using the camera is improved. Moreover, the friction member is constituted by a rubber member made of silicone rubber or the like. Thus, the considerable miniaturization of the camera is achieved.

  • Patent number: 5251402
    Abstract: A self return mechanism for automatically closing or opening a closure, preferably having a movable door supported during movement by a door frame, the door having a braking element mounted to the top edge of the door, and a door return element. The door return element has one end coupled to the door frame structure and its other end coupled to the door and has an intermediate segment oriented to pass through the braking element and around a portion of the grooved circumference of a pulley wheel. The door return element is preferably an elastic element having an outer dimension that changes as the door moves from an opened position to a closed position. The self return mechanism controls the acceleration and deceleration of the door as it is automatically closed, returns the sliding door to its closed position when it is opened only partially, allows for easy removal and replacement of the door from the door frame structure and is inexpensive to manufacture and simple to assemble.

  • Patent number: 4819299
    Abstract: A self-closing hinge comprising a pair of hinge leaves pivotally interconnected by an offset hinge pin. A spring tang is formed integrally with one of the hinge members and has a distal end that has a head projecting substantially radially with respect to a sleeve of the other hinge leaf within which the hinge pin is mounted. The external surface of the sleeve serves as a cam surface against which a follower element carried on the head of the spring tang is biased. The line of force exerted by the head of the tang through the follower is distally offset relative to the axis of the hinge pin. During closing of the hinge the follower is brought into registration with a pocket formed in the sleeve effecting a rocking movement of the follower about one edge of the pocket to generate a self-closing moment.

  • Patent number: 4761853
    Abstract: A geared hinge is formed by a pair of intermeshed geared hinge members which are maintained in mesh by a connector member. When the hinge members are in one position there are longitudinal recesses which are diminished in volume when the hinge members are in an alternate position. Deposits of resilient rubber-like material are inserted into the open recesses. These deposits are compressed when the hinge members are moved toward the alternate position. The resistance to compression imparts a self-closing action to the hinge.
